Package Details: python39 3.9.20-1

Git Clone URL: https://aur.archlinux.org/python39.git (read-only, click to copy)
Package Base: python39
Description: Major release 3.9 of the Python high-level programming language
Upstream URL: https://www.python.org/
Licenses: PSF-2.0
Submitter: rixx
Maintainer: rixx
Last Packager: rixx
Votes: 25
Popularity: 0.28
First Submitted: 2021-12-13 11:56 (UTC)
Last Updated: 2024-11-06 08:35 (UTC)

Dependencies (16)

Required by (7)

Sources (2)

Latest Comments

« First ‹ Previous 1 2 3 4

Aviroblox commented on 2022-01-21 21:19 (UTC) (edited on 2022-01-25 00:10 (UTC) by Aviroblox)

I'm getting this error when updating to 3.9.10 from 3.9.9

LD_LIBRARY_PATH=/home/avanish/.cache/yay/python39/src/Python-3.9.10 CC='gcc -pthread' LDSHARED='gcc -pthread -shared -Wl,-O1,--sort-common,--as-needed,-z,relro,-z,now -Wl,-O1,--sort-common,--as-needed,-z,relro,-z,now -flto -fuse-linker-plugin -ffat-lto-objects -flto-partition=none -g ' OPT='-DNDEBUG -g -fwrapv -O3 -Wall'    _TCLTK_INCLUDES='' _TCLTK_LIBS=''      ./python -E ./setup.py  build
Traceback (most recent call last):
  File "/home/avanish/.cache/yay/python39/src/Python-3.9.10/./setup.py", line 36, in <module>
    from distutils.command.install import install
  File "/home/avanish/.local/lib/python3.9/site-packages/setuptools/_distutils/command/install.py", line 20, in <module>
    from .. import _collections
  File "/home/avanish/.local/lib/python3.9/site-packages/setuptools/__init__.py", line 16, in <module>
    import setuptools.version
  File "/home/avanish/.local/lib/python3.9/site-packages/setuptools/version.py", line 1, in <module>
    import pkg_resources
  File "/home/avanish/.local/lib/python3.9/site-packages/pkg_resources/__init__.py", line 23, in <module>
    import zipfile
  File "/home/avanish/.cache/yay/python39/src/Python-3.9.10/Lib/zipfile.py", line 6, in <module>
    import binascii
ModuleNotFoundError: No module named 'binascii'
make: *** [Makefile:640: sharedmods] Error 1
make: *** Waiting for unfinished jobs....

vhsdev commented on 2022-01-01 11:54 (UTC)

Python requires a bluetooth library to build‽

Only if the crypto wallet requiring this package to build is able to connect to the Internet of Bodies. I believe the electron-cash wallet relies on py39. Just saying.

rixx commented on 2021-12-15 10:59 (UTC)

While this package was deleted, I adjusted the PKGBUILD to match the official ABS Python PKGBUILD, on the assumption that Arch maintainers know better than me what is needed to build Python. Feel free to remove (either for yourself or via a PR) if not actually needed.

alerque commented on 2021-12-15 10:03 (UTC)

Python requires a bluetooth library to build‽